Pytest-django: Version 3.10.0

Créé le 22 août 2020  ·  11Commentaires  ·  Source: pytest-dev/pytest-django

Il y a quelques correctifs de compatibilité qui seraient bien de sortir:

  • Correctif pour pytest-xdist 2
  • Correctif pour pytest 6 (tests internes pytest-django uniquement)
  • Correctif pour Django 3.2

Je n'ai jamais fait de publication ici auparavant, mais si je comprends bien, il suffit de pousser une mise à jour du journal des modifications et de la taguer, et elle est publiée automatiquement à l'aide du jeton PyPI de @blueyed .

Je le ferai dans quelques jours, à moins que quelqu'un ne s'y oppose (ou ne se porte volontaire).

Commentaire le plus utile

@bluetech @pelme avez-vous une chance d'aider à la publication de cette version ?

Tous les 11 commentaires

Eh bien j'ai essayé mais il semble que le jeton n'est plus valide:

HTTPError: 403 Forbidden from https://upload.pypi.org/legacy/
Invalid or non-existent authentication information. See https://pypi.org/help/#invalid-auth for more information.

(Voir le travail : https://travis-ci.org/github/pytest-dev/pytest-django/jobs/721042875).

Alors maintenant, c'est un peu le bordel avec la version validée et taguée mais non publiée sur PyPI...

@blueyed et @pelme : selon https://pypi.org/project/pytest-django/ vous êtes les utilisateurs qui ont la permission de publier sur PyPI. Pensez-vous que vous pourriez publier manuellement la roue, ou mettre à jour le jeton travis peut-être ? Désolé pour le désordre, j'espérais que ça marcherait.

@bluetech si vous utilisez setup.py upload , essayez plutôt twine upload . Il semble que le premier ait été cassé récemment, du moins pour mes projets.

Je suis désolé, je ne peux pas t'aider avec ça.

@bluetech @pelme avez-vous une chance d'aider à la publication de cette version ?

(Depuis https://github.com/pytest-dev/pytest/issues/7585#issuecomment-691510957) :

@pelme pourriez-vous m'ajouter et/ou @bluetech en tant qu'éditeurs sur PyPI ? Nous pouvons partir de là (mon nom d'utilisateur est également nicoddemus ). @bluetech c'est quoi le tien ?

Désolé pour le retard. J'ai ajouté @nicoddemus en tant que propriétaire sur PyPI maintenant. Je ne connaissais pas le nom d'utilisateur PyPI de @bluetech mais répondez ici et je vous ajouterai aussi !

Merci 🙏 et faites-moi savoir si je peux être d'une autre aide.

@pelme Super, merci !

Mon nom d'utilisateur PyPI est bluetech (juste créé en fait). Une fois ajouté, je compléterai cette version.

@bluetech Génial ! Vous êtes maintenant invité sur PyPI.

3.10.0 est maintenant disponible sur PyPI.


Notez que j'ai effectué le téléchargement localement; J'ai essayé de mettre à jour le jeton dans le fichier travis, mais lorsque j'essaie de chiffrer le nouveau jeton, cela donne une erreur indiquant que le jeton est trop long... Je trouverai cependant un peu de temps pour enquêter avant la prochaine version. Peut-être simplement passer aux actions github ?

Peut-être simplement passer aux actions github ?

Ça semble être une bonne idée. Vous pouvez ensuite stocker les clés dans le magasin secret de github.

Cette page vous a été utile?
0 / 5 - 0 notes